Cutting-Edge Technologies
At its core, Fedora 25 delivered the latest advancements in Linux technology. The kernel was updated to version 4.8, offering improved performance, better hardware compatibility, and new features such as enhanced support for virtual machines and containers. With the inclusion of updated libraries and programming languages, developers found FC25 to be a fertile ground for innovation.
Enhanced Software Ecosystem
The introduction of Flatpak support in Fedora 25 revolutionized how software was distributed and managed. Flatpaks provided an independent layer for applications, ensuring consistency across different Linux distributions. This move was a step forward in addressing the age-old issue of package compatibility in the Linux world.
